I've made about 7 x65 siemens accessories for now.
- Three 3.5mm audio converters
- Two USB DCA-540 data cables
- One Car charger
- One Aikon to Siemens charger adapter (u know Siemens phones & chargers are rare in Egypt)
One major obstacle when creating an accessory is the connector, I had to search for an old headset or data cable for just cutting its slim lumberg connector.
But I managed to create my own (Open source ) connectors from nothing.
So, I checked all cables & wires in my garage & found it . It's a cable like ones inside:
1- CD-ROM drives (I had two dead ones)
2- CD players (an old Sony Hi-Fi)
3- Inkjet printers (a dead Epson)
it's the only suitable type because the distance between its wires is the same as it's between those in the phone connector
like this one
=================================
for one slim lumberg, you need about 4CM long, 14-wire wide of this cable in average.
I could get about 3 Meters of this cable
Phone connector needs 12 wires, but you'll cut a 14-wire wide piece of this cable (the extra 2 wires are not to be connected, but for best fit into phone)
Then it's easy to (expose) the 12 wires at both ends
--------
Then find or make a (base) of plastic or rubber with diemensions fitting into the phone. Glue the cable over the plastic base.
That's all

I'll make a white LED lamp. Now I have a spot of 2 Ir LEDs & it's great for night vision through the phone camera.
I made an IMS-700 3.5mm connector with-----> Karaoke effect (on/off)
just solder a switch to pin "9" then, switch on=normal voice, switch off=Karaoke
